How much do video trainer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for video trainer in the United States is $26.18,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.63 and $29.57 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Paszkiewicz Litigation Services provides litigation services to law firms and businesses throughout the U.S. We are seeking talented individuals to join our growing team in Glen Carbon. This is a full-time, onsite position.

Position Summary:

Video Representatives are responsible for ensuring the seamless execution of depositions and proceedings via videoconference. Comprehensive training will be provided to proficiently navigate various platforms and handle video and audio files. This is a full-time position reporting to the Video Manager.


Responsibilities

  • Executes Paszkiewicz Video Process as trained by the Video Manager.
  • Monitor & record videoconference proceedings and provide general troubleshooting support.
  • Strong communication skills with clients and internal employees.
  • Efficiently create, process, and deliver video files per Paszkiewicz Video Process. Working with Production and Billing teams to adhere to company procedures.
  • Prioritize and execute tasks in alignment with client and company needs.
  • Undertake miscellaneous tasks as required by the video team workflow and the Video Manager.
  • Self-starter who is motivated to grow within the company.


Requirements

  • Exceptional communication, organizational, customer service skills.
  • Meticulous attention to detail and strong multi-tasking capabilities.
  • Possess solid critical thinking, time management skills, and work successfully in a team environment.
  • Computer literacy with a desire for growth in learning diverse software platforms including Microsoft applications.
  • Flexibility to work varying hours on weekdays, when necessary, per client and company needs.
  • Demonstrates unwavering commitment to maintaining confidentiality.
  • Experience working in the legal field, or with video is preferred but not required.
